Christiana Aguilera was born December 18th, 1980 in Staten Island, New York. She first appeared on national television at the age of 10 as a contestant on the Star Search programme, which lead her to star in a Disney channle television series The New Mickey Mouse Club from 1993–1994. Along side other famous artists such as Britney Spears and Justine Timberlake.
RCA records signed Christiana after recording her first single Reflections for the film Mulan. This then lead her to her first album in 1999 which was very successful and included songs such as 'Genie In a Bottle,' 'What a Girl Wants' and 'I Turn To You'. In this album Christianas image is very innocent, younge and sweet and so are the messages and stories within her music. This was due to the target audience she had intended for her music.In the video 'Genie In A Bottle' she has natural make up on, everyday clothes, younge and fun elements like the dance routine and concept of liking a boy. This album is where she got her first grammies and got her name out there.

Further into her carrer she changed her image and produced new material under the album title called Stripped. Which sold over 330,000 copies in the first week. Unlike like her previous album, this one showed more of her raunchy side. Where she started to do photoshots nude and semi-nude for magazine, including the rolling stones. Although this image was frowned upon in the US her work was very successful, with 4 singles reaching number one.
It wasn't just about her music anymore it was all about her performance and image. The idea that she was seen in a sexual way was new to her previous work. Her jeans with holes in - so that her knickers where on show was a typical costume that shocked many fans. The 'Dirty' video with raunchy dance moves also brought out a this new side to her.

In 2004 Christina took a more mature approach with her 'Back To Basics' album. This was seen as a good choice and saw many praises. She soon died her hair to flaxen blonde and cut it short, with bright red lipstick to take a more Marilyn Monroe approach to bring back the 1920s image of Holywood Glamour.
